I find that hotels at New Year are very pricey as they all seem to put on entertainment and dinner dance type things and then sell all this as a package.
For that reason we tend to avoid hotels and opt for a cottage but also find that the minimum time you can rent for over this period is 5 days - which again pushes up the cost.
The only thing is to wait until much nearer the time to see if you can rent for a shorter period.
Either that or go for a budget-type hotel where you'll just get a clean bed and maybe breakfast if you're lucky then look around for a nice restaurant in your area of choice, and book a table now so that at least you'll get some food on New Years Eve/Day.
